Kohunlich

This experience begins when we depart from the hotel and ride on our bicycles 2km until we reach the archaeological zone. Kohunlich is the most important archaeological site of this region. You will be able to climb some of the most representative pyramids, including “Los Mascarones”, where you will have a better view of the ruins and of the Mayan jungle.

The name Kohunlich is the mayan adaptation of Cohoon Ridge as was known by the English colonies of the 18th Century, and originates from the abundance of Cahoon trees (Orbignya Cohune) that grow in the region.

Kohunlich is currently considered one of the most important Mayan cities of the lower Peten. The buildings’ style clearly reflects the influence of the structures found at the shore of The Bec River (north of the Yucatan Peninsula) and on those in Guatemala’s southern region. There is also evidence of some kind of historic link with the Copan ruins in Honduras.

The most important archaeological sites are: the Temple of the Sun, with its enormous 5 feet masks, which represent the god of the “Young Sun”; Kinch Ahau, the Ball Field, Palace of the Stelas and the Acropolis.

The grand diversity of trees (copal, rubber, gum, pepper and ceiba) in combination with a great variety of animals (deer, armadillos, foxes, howling monkeys, small mammals, parrots, toucans and many others) make of Kohunlich a magical, exotic and refreshing place.

Dzibanche

We will explore the archaeological site by visiting the Temple of Lintels (Templo de los Dinteles) and the Temple of the Owl (Templo del Búho). A walk of approximately one and a half hour. We will interpret the local flora and fauna.

Considered the most important Mayan city within the state of Quintana Roo. Dizibanché once housed 40 thousand inhabitants during the classic period. There is solid evidence about Kinichná being its satellite city, and Kohunlich paying tribute to this great metropolis.

Kinichná owes its name to a VII Century wooden lintel covered with glyphs that shows signs of Teotihuacan influence within the central part of the region. A cultural wonder surrounded by jungle.

Located 20 miles from the hotel, you can visit this interesting archaeological site by car, bike or simply walking and enjoying the adventure and the thousands of buildings still buried in the jungle.

Sites in Campeche

We will visit three archaeological sites in Campeche, which are 75Km away from The Explorean Kohunlich: Xpuhil, Becan and Chicaná.

The majestic Balam-Ku’s, Becan and its protective wall, the mystic Chicaná door that connects to the underworld, the third tower of Xpujil, the exquisite “Fachada del Hormiguero” or Hormiguero Façade, and the Calakmul biosphere reserve, are just some examples of Campeche’s historic treasures.

Discover and value the culture of each place and take a guided tour along the most enigmatic places in Campeche, a land where the Mayan culture produced its most exceptional achievements.

Solve the most intriguing archaeological mysteries… Every Mayan Stela, ceramic figure and glyph has a special meaning. Campeche is a place that beholds innumerable wonders that are yet to be discovered.

Chichan-Há

We will visit a forest reserve in the Ejido de Caobas, intending to find the vestiges of a 16th Century Franciscan Convent. An excellent opportunity to explore the flora and fauna of its jungle. Ideal for biking an 8km trail.

Journey back in time and discover Chichan-Há, one of the few colonial places that subsist in Quintana Roo State. It was once a Franciscan Mission where the Mayas turned to for shelter during war periods. It is also one of the most important sustainable forest exploration projects in Latin America.

Peaceful Mayan inhabitants, under missionary compliance, built this interesting site. Dissidents from Bacalar and Chetumal later made an attack on Chichan-Há, destroying its buildings and killing almost all the population.

The jungle reveals something fascinating and mysterious when innumerable candles are lit as an offering over the human remains found by hunters and gum trees workers of the region.

Visit and get to know one of Mexico’s most successful wood exploitation projects. A mountain bike is the perfect means of transportation to live this adventure.

Bacalar

We will travel 1hour and 15 minutes until we find the beautiful lagoon of Bacalar. We will kayak through the crystalline7-color waters and, if the wind favors it, we will have the opportunity to sail in a 9-foot Catamaran.

Also known as the Lagoon of Seven Colors, it’s a wonderful and spectacular water extension reaching 26 miles long and in some points, 1 mile wide. A transparent beauty, that originates from a complex subterranean river system that will make you feel completely free.

Bacalar Lagoon is perfect for kayak, sailing on a catamaran or just swimming and walking through its borders and enjoying the amazing beauty offered by this place.

Chakanbakan

We will travel 40 minutes until we reach Chakanbakan Lagoon where we will have the opportunity to kayak between reed beds visiting the natural habitat of the Moreleti crocodile and other species of Flora and Fauna. This is an excellent chance to enjoy the jungle by night and discover the wonders that the night sky and darkness have to offer.

Not very far from the hotel lies a spectacular lagoon that exhibits a wide variety of plants and animals. In this place you will feel a part of the natural scenery as guano palm trees, tall mahogany trees, oak trees, deer, badger families, crocodiles and different species of birds surround you.

Chakanbakan was created to enjoy the warm and extraordinary sunsets than can be viewed from this site. In this way you can take advantage of the best light for taking pictures and appreciating the beauty of the place. Enjoy the legends that are told by our local tourist guides.
